WebDec 27, 2024 · Coracobrachialis is the most medial muscle in the anterior compartment of the arm.Its attachments at the coracoid process of the scapula and the anterior surface of the shaft of humerus make coracobrachialis a strong adductor of the arm. Additionally, this muscle is also a weak flexor of the arm at the shoulder joint. All ... phlegm blood tingedWebA common cause of neck and arm pain is a pinched nerve, also known as cervical radiculopathy. Several structures in the cervical spine can cause pressure on a nerve as it branches from the spinal cord to travel down your arm where it provides motor and sensory function.
